The first step in a mesothelioma legal lawsuit is to schedule a free initial consultation with a qualified lawyer. The lawyer will review the case and determine if you have a valid claim. This will be determined by various aspects, including the extent of your exposure to asbestos as well as the kind of illness that you've developed as a consequence of this.
If you have a mesothelioma diagnosis, your attorney will need to review your medical records and your employment history to determine the cause of your exposure to asbestos. They'll also need to see if you qualify for VA benefits. The VA provides monthly payments and medical assistance to veterans who have been exposed to asbestos during the military.
A typical mesothelioma lawsuit can take as long as two years to be resolved. This is because a lawsuit involves an extensive amount of research, filing, and attending court hearings and motions. There are also state laws which limit the time to file a lawsuit.

The majority of mesothelioma lawsuits settle with a settlement, instead of a verdict from a judge. This is because the patients and their families don't want to endure a lengthy tiring trial. These firms will do everything to ensure that their clients receive the best settlement they can.
Mesothelioma victims can receive compensation for lost income, medical bills, and suffering. Families may also be eligible for wrongful death awards in the case that a loved one died of mesothelioma. Patients with mesothelioma claim may be able to submit a claim for disability compensation with the Veteran's Administration.
The value of a claim for mesothelioma is based on a number of factors, such as the length of time that the patient has suffered from the disease and the stage at which they were diagnosed. Each case is unique and there is no accurate way to predict how much mesothelioma claim victims will receive in a settlement or trial verdict.
In addition to seeking financial compensation, mesothelioma lawyers can assist veterans with obtaining VA disability benefits as well as asbestos trust fund claims. There's more than $30 billion in asbestos trust funds, and the majority of veterans can access this cash without ever needing to enter a courtroom. Mesothelioma sufferers and their families could also file a lawsuit for personal injury or wrongful deaths against asbestos-related companies that put their health at risk.
Cost
Typically mesothelioma lawyers will not charge upfront fees. They instead work on a contingent basis, which means that they are only paid if the case is successful. Your lawyer will receive a percentage of any settlement or verdict. Be aware that there are other options for attorney fees, like flat rates or hourly fees.

A mesothelioma suit could be filed against multiple defendants. The defendants could be insurers, manufacturers or any other party who knowingly exposed people with asbestos. The plaintiff must show that the defendant was owed a duty of diligence to take reasonable precautions to guard against exposure and that they breached this duty. The plaintiff has to demonstrate that the breach led to their injuries, including a mesothelioma diagnose. Expert testimony is often needed to establish the liability and determine the amount of damages. The expert must testify to the incompetence of the defendant, which resulted in mesothelioma being diagnosed and other injuries.
